Bill Simmons Says He Heard Draymond Green Call LeBron James A ‘F*ckboy’ During Game 4 Dust-Up

It has been about a week since we saw the Golden State Warriors’ Draymond Green hit Cleveland Cavs superstar LeBron James in the dick after LBJ stepped over him during Game 4 of the NBA Finals. And while Green got suspended for Game 5 following the altercation, everyone wondered what words were exchanged between the two immediately afterwards.

Bill Simmons may have leaked the truth during his podcast today with guest Jimmy Butler of the Chicago Bulls.

“I heard Draymond, I heard he didn’t say the b-word. I heard it began with an F and ended with boy,” Simmons said. “That’s why I think LeBron took it so personally. I’m sure LeBron has been called the b-word before. He really got upset, his feelings got hurt. It’s really hard to hurt LeBron’s feelings. … Something happened.”

It was originally believed that Green dropped the ol’  “bitch” or “pussy” on James, which caused people to call LeBron soft for not being able to take the simple insult. The Internet reacted to the news that it might have actually been “fuckboy” instead.
